I tried a RO water filter system, but my water is so good and the amount of waste could not be justified.
Do you have water issues or just prefer RO water?
Well u did not specifically say what model u have cause many cheap models are like 2-4+ waste:r/o water . Mines 1:1 and I also use a booster pump to make my psi 150 (3-5x than normal), my model when booster on at higher temps is rated for 2k galls per day . My water is well water and very high in pathogens and super high in iron and many heavy metals and since I live in ag zone tons of farmers really have made my water iffy I wanna use. my ppm for my water is 350-400 ppm and ph 8.5. I can get my ppm 0-50 for 2-3 years in this system without replacments and being well water my pathogen rate is high and if u do mass clones or seedlings I really do noitce my sucess/death rate def shows if I don’t filter/ro and uvc clean my water . so yes I do have water issues and want 100% control of what I’m inputting and giving in my tea’s/drenches .

I even have a bigger system connected directly to my whole house and that reduces the cost of my r/o filters and one step preventive for my piping to drinking/water being cleaner . My whole house filter is tall filters like my r/o but pre sediment + sediment + ACB + KDF + xl uvc . this really helps but I still willing to use r/o for flower room & clones/seedlings (they are way more sensitive at that stage). if I could afford it I would even have r/o for my veg room but that’s 2x the filters and being I’m not doing hydro and plants look good I think I’ll just skip that.

well here’s current “transplant” and weekly tea



✅ 55-GALLON LIQUID TEA (BIOLOGICALLY BALANCED)
🔹 BASE WATER
  • 55 gal RO / dechlorinated water
  • Strong aeration
  • Target water temp: 65–72°F
🔹 BREW PHASE (12–24 HOURS)
These go in during the brew
1️⃣ RAW NPK Silica
✔ Rate: ¼ cup per 55 gal
MOA:

  • Strengthens cell walls
  • Improves stress tolerance
  • Enhances disease resistance
    🟡 Note: RAW silica is potassium silicate → keep pH in check
2️⃣ RAW NPK Cal/Mag
✔ Rate: 2 Tbsp per 55 gal
MOA:

  • Calcium for cell structure & root tips
  • Magnesium for chlorophyll
  • Prevents Ca/Mg drawdown during microbial bloom
    ✅ Safe at this low rate
3️⃣ RAW NPK Kelp
⚠️ Corrected Rate: ⅛–¼ cup per 55 gal (not ¼ cup if you’re also using Terp Tea Grow)
MOA:

  • Cytokinins & auxins (root branching)
  • Stress mitigation
  • Feeds microbes indirectly
    🚫 Too much = hormonal overstimulation
4️⃣ RAW NPK Full-Up (Fulvic Acid)
✔ Rate: ¼ cup per 55 gal
MOA:

  • Chelates micronutrients
  • Improves nutrient uptake
  • Enhances microbial transport
    Excellent choice here
5️⃣ RAW NPK Humic Acid
✔ Rate: ¼ cup per 55 gal
MOA:

  • Carbon source for microbes
  • Improves CEC
  • Buffers nutrient availability
    Key for mineralization of Terp Tea inputs
6️⃣ RAW NPK Amino Acids
✔ Rate: ¼ cup per 55 gal
MOA:

  • Direct nitrogen source
  • Reduces plant energy cost
  • Improves microbial metabolism
    Good synergy with kelp & humics

7️⃣ Terp Tea Grow
⚠️ Slight correction: 1–1.25 cups per 55 gal
(1.5 cups is safe but aggressive when stacked with Uprising / frass / other N sources)
MOA:

  • Organic NPK
  • Beneficial fungi & bacteria
  • Long-term nutrient release
    Primary nutrient backbone
8️⃣ Terp Tea Microbe Charge
✔ Rate: 1–1.5 cups per 55 gal
MOA:

  • Rapid microbial population increase
  • Helps dominate rhizosphere
  • Improves breakdown speed
    Perfect in a brewed tea
⏱ Brew Time
  • 12–18 hrs = bacterial dominant
  • 18–24 hrs = more fungal balance
    ✔ Do not exceed 24 hrs for max micfobes , can be used if proper aeration 7-10 days
🔹 POST-BREW / JUST BEFORE USE
These are NOT brewed — add after aeration stops or right before drenching

9️⃣ Continuµm
✔ Rate: 25–60 mL per 55 gal
MOA:

  • Broad-spectrum microbial insurance
  • Stabilizes biology across rez refills
  • Reduces competition stress
    Use lower end if also using Bio-Force later
🔟 MicroLife Liquid BTi
✔ Rate: 25–60 mL per 55 gal
MOA:

  • Targets fungus gnat larvae
  • No effect on bacteria or fungi
  • Preventative IPM layer
    Excellent inclusion
1️⃣1️⃣ OG BioWar Root Pack
⚠️ Corrected Rate: ½–1 cup per 55 gal (MAX)
MOA

  • Trichoderma root colonization
  • Pathogen suppression
  • Enzyme production
    🚫 1 cup is already heavy — no need to exceed
1️⃣2️⃣ OG BioWar Nute Pack
⚠️ Corrected Rate: ½–1 cup per 55 gal
MOA:

  • Nutrient solubilization
  • Mineralization of organic inputs
  • Supports uptake of Terp Tea Grow
    Again — higher ≠ better here
+
Regalia @1-5ml per gal ( every 14-21 days drench)
MOA:
  • Regalia stimulates the plant to produce its own protective compounds like phytoalexins, pathogenesis-related (PR) proteins, and enzymes that strengthen cell walls.
  • SAR/ISR





🔹 FINAL pH
  • Adjust AFTER brew, BEFORE application / adding biologicals
  • Target: 5.8–6.3
  • Don’t chase exact numbers — stability > precision

✅ MATURE VEG BIO / NPK FOLIAR

Water: 1.25 gal RO
pH target: 5.8–6.2
Coverage: Tops mainly (underside light mist optional)



🧪 RECIPE
  • Impello Dune → 1.25 mL
    MOA: Monosilicic acid strengthens cell walls, improves stress & pest resistance.
  • Grease Alpha → 7.5 mL
    MOA: Penetrant/sticker; improves foliar uptake and biological adhesion.
  • RAW Yucca → 1/8 tsp
    MOA: Natural surfactant; improves wetting and spread.
  • RAW Full-Up → 1/8tsp
    MOA: Fulvic acid chelation; increases nutrient transport across leaf cuticle.
  • RAW Kelp → 1/8 tsp
    MOA: Cytokinins/auxins; promotes vegetative vigor and branching.
  • RAW Amino Acids → 1/8tsp
    MOA: Supplies pre-formed amino acids; reduces metabolic load.
  • Regalia → 30 mL
    MOA: SAR inducer; primes plant immune response (phytoalexins).
  • OG Biowar Foliar Pack → ~1.5 Tbsp
    MOA: Beneficial microbes colonize leaf surface; ISR + pathogen exclusion.
  • Venerate XC → 3.75 Tbsp
    MOA: Enzymatic metabolites disrupt insect cuticle/gut; non-systemic.


🕒 APPLICATION
  • Lights off
  • No runoff (dull sheen only)
  • 3-5hr no lights min
  • Restore airflow after 15–20 min
  • No oils/knockouts ±5–7 days
 
Moved final smalls ( besides seeds on shelf), also up-potted doubles to 5 gals and have em on side. indoors i really try to avoid waste sqft or ppfd on runts and if they appear later to suck replace. i have so many times in past played the game with allowing plants that suck to be in good zones or keep a prime bed just because. well even if i have to place a 5 gal double net to it and shade it if proven crappy np. key is not expecting when u spot crappy pheno to have that bed zone usable since in bloom. this is why also i have the movable 2x2 beds "city picker" so if seedlings or results show obvious diff in size and stretch i can reorganize from shortest-tallest zones. i used to do 4x8 tables with 5 gal pots. issue with trellis and seedlings if they arent same size or things hidden in spots u cant turn in 360 degree cause of trellis u def might get hermies u miss/pests/issues. i loved trellis for along time but i really love the 360 movable beds , even taking pics and examining the plants alive by moving them to non grow ppfd zone to look is nice.

Applied yesterday-today Mid–late veg top-dress program

Use rate: every 2–4 weeks (biweekly for fast veg / heavy feeders, every 4 weeks for steady veg)
Application: Evenly top-dress → lightly scratch in → water in (or follow with compost tea)


---
🌱 MID–LATE VEG TOP DRESS

Container: 15-gallon City Picker (2×2)
Interval:** Every 2–4 weeks


---
1. DIY ELEMENTAL @ ¼ cup

**Mode of Action:**
• Broad-spectrum mineral amendment
• Supplies trace elements (Fe, Mn, Zn, Cu, B, Mo)
• Supports enzyme function and microbial metabolism
• Prevents hidden micronutrient deficiencies during rapid veg growth

**Why it matters in veg:**
Veg plants ramp enzyme activity hard—micros keep growth efficient and leaves dark without pushing N.

---
2. Terp Tea Grow @ ¼ cup

**Mode of Action:**
• Organic NPK (veg-biased)
• Feeds soil microbes *and* plant simultaneously
• Contains meals + composted inputs for slow, steady nitrogen release

**Why it matters in veg:**
Primary **engine of vegetative growth** without salt spikes or stretchy growth.

---
3. Uprising Grow** – **¼ cup**

**Mode of Action:**
• Complementary organic nitrogen + phosphorus
• Strengthens root mass and early branching
• Slightly faster mineralization than Terp Tea alone

**Why it matters in veg:**
Stacks with Terp Tea to **increase node stacking, lateral growth, and vigor** without excess softness.

---
4. Crab Meal @¼ cup

**Mode of Action:**
• Chitin source → stimulates chitinase-producing microbes
• Indirect pest & disease resistance (ISR response)
• Provides Ca + trace minerals

**Why it matters in veg:**
Builds **natural IPM resistance** early and strengthens cell walls before bloom.

---
5. MicroLife Humic Plus -¼ cups

**Mode of Action:**

• Humic & fulvic acids improve nutrient chelation
• Increases CEC (nutrient holding capacity)
• Enhances microbial colonization and root uptake

**Why it matters in veg:**
Makes everything above **more bioavailable** and reduces lockout risk.

---

### ✅ APPLICATION NOTES

• Evenly distribute over soil surface

• Lightly scratch into top 1–2 inches
• Water in thoroughly (plain water or biological tea)
• Best applied **3–7 days before heavy veg push or training**


---

### ⏱️ FREQUENCY GUIDE
• **Aggressive veg / topping / training:** Every **2 weeks**
• **Steady veg / minimal stress:** Every **3–4 weeks*
